Sump Pump Plumbing in Dothan, AL
Sump pump plumbing services involve installing, repairing, and maintaining sump pumps to help protect homes from flooding and excess water buildup. These services typically cover the installation of new sump pumps, replacement of outdated or malfunctioning units, and troubleshooting issues such as frequent cycling, noise, or failure to activate. Property owners often seek sump pump services when preparing for heavy rain seasons, experiencing water intrusion, or noticing signs of pump failure, to ensure their basements and lower levels remain dry and secure.
Before requesting sump pump plumbing, homeowners should understand the type of sump pump best suited for their property, such as pedestal or submersible models, and whether additional drainage or backup systems are recommended. It's also helpful to consider the location of the sump pit, the power supply, and any existing plumbing connections. Clear information about water flow patterns and previous flooding issues can assist in selecting the most effective solution to safeguard the property against water damage.

Sump Pump Plumbing Questions
What is a sump pump and why is it important? A sump pump helps remove excess water from basements or crawl spaces, preventing flooding and water damage during heavy rains or leaks.
How do I know if my sump pump needs repair or replacement? Signs include frequent cycling, strange noises, or failure to turn on during wet conditions. Regular checks can help identify issues early.
What types of sump pumps are available for homes? Common options include pedestal and submersible sump pumps, each suited for different space and performance needs.
What are common reasons for sump pump failure? Power outages, clogged discharge lines, and worn-out float switches are typical causes of sump pump malfunctions.
